Liability waivers are common in the recreational context and the sporting world, as a means of limiting the financial exposure of those who operate such enterprises. These waivers often intimidate prospective injury plaintiffs, and for good reason in Pennsylvania, liability waivers are generally enforceable.

In Pennsylvania, such liability waivers, or exculpatory agreements, are generally enforceable, except in cases of intentional, reckless, or grossly negligent conduct.

A waiver is a legally binding provision where either party in a contract agrees to voluntarily forfeit a claim without the other party being liable. Waivers can either be in written form or some form of action.

In Pennsylvania, the Superior Court confirmed that if the conduct is grossly negligent and/or reckless, that the victim may sue regardless of a release.
